在GUI编程中,tkinter是Python中常用的图形用户界面(GUI)库。它提供了创建窗口、按钮、标签等各种GUI组件的功能。
当使用tkinter创建窗口并输入label时无法赋值的原因可能有以下几种情况:
text
属性来设置Label组件的文本内容。以下是一个示例代码,演示了如何使用tkinter创建窗口并给Label组件赋值:
import tkinter as tk
def set_label_text():
label.config(text="Hello, World!")
window = tk.Tk()
label = tk.Label(window, text="Initial Text")
label.pack()
button = tk.Button(window, text="Set Label Text", command=set_label_text)
button.pack()
window.mainloop()
在上述示例中,我们创建了一个窗口并在窗口中添加了一个Label组件和一个Button组件。当点击按钮时,调用set_label_text
函数来设置Label组件的文本内容为"Hello, World!"。
关于tkinter的更多信息和使用方法,你可以参考腾讯云的相关文档和教程:
请注意,以上仅为示例推荐的腾讯云产品,并非广告宣传。你可以根据具体需求选择适合的云计算产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云